Output 847054c617e1ee6afef56156f51be0c9156e28d74d234989d1891a66761607e6:41

value
561771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b541c701eee1bca83afb0fae1fa4a09fe65d14 OP_EQUAL
address
3Bbp3DQDr6wN8w2rV5KkXv8sjegsAEut2i
transaction
847054c617e1ee6afef56156f51be0c9156e28d74d234989d1891a66761607e6